Benefits of Bicycle Home Exercise
Cardiovascular Health

Cycling on a stationary bicycle is an excellent form of cardiovascular exercise. It assists enhance heart health, increases lung capacity, and enhances general endurance. Regular biking can minimize the danger of cardiovascular disease, lower high blood pressure, and enhance cholesterol levels.
Low Impact

Unlike running or high-impact aerobics, biking is a low-impact activity that is mild on the joints. This makes it especially suitable for individuals with knee or hip concerns, along with those who are recovering from injuries.
Muscle Toning

Biking primarily works the lower body, toning the quadriceps, hamstrings, calves, and glutes. Additionally, core muscles are engaged to keep balance and stability, resulting in a more thorough exercise machine.
Weight-loss

Stationary biking can be an effective way to burn calories and help in weight reduction. Depending upon the strength and duration of the workout, you can burn between 400 to 1000 calories per hour, making it an effective tool for fat decrease.
Mental Health

Exercise is understood to launch endorphins, the "feel-good" hormones that assist reduce stress and stress and anxiety. Cycling, in specific, can be a meditative and peaceful activity, especially when integrated with virtual cycling videos or scenic routes.
Convenience and Flexibility

Among the most substantial benefits of a bicycle home exercise is the benefit. You can work out at any time, without the requirement to take a trip to a health club or wait on equipment. This flexibility makes it simpler to maintain a consistent physical fitness regimen.
Getting Started with Bicycle Home Exercise
Select the Right Bike

Upright Bikes: These simulate the conventional biking experience and are great for those who choose a more athletic posture.
Recumbent Bikes: These use a reclined seating position, which is much easier on the back and joints. They are perfect for people with lower pain in the back or balance concerns.
Spin Bikes: These are designed for high-intensity period training (HIIT) and can supply a more tough exercise.
Set Up Your Space

Ensure you have enough area for your bike, ideally in a location with good ventilation. Location a mat or towel beneath the bike to safeguard your floor.
Position a mirror in front of you to examine your type and posture.
Think about purchasing a water bottle holder, towel bar, and a fan to keep you hydrated and cool throughout your exercises.
Use Appropriate Clothing

Select breathable, moisture-wicking clothes to stay comfy throughout your workout. Biking shorts and an encouraging top are suggested.
Wear well-fitted shoes that can grip the pedals firmly. Cleats or specialized biking shoes can boost your efficiency.
Adjust the Bike

Seat Height: Adjust the seat so that your legs are a little bent at the bottom of the pedal stroke.
Handlebars: Position the handlebars to a comfy height. For upright bikes, they ought to be at the exact same height as the seat or slightly lower.
Resistance: Start with a low resistance level and gradually increase as your fitness enhances.
Methods for Effective Workouts
Warm-Up and Cool-Down

Warm-Up: Begin with a 5-10 minute gentle ride to increase your heart rate and warm up your muscles. You can also include vibrant stretches like leg exercise machine swings and arm circles.
Cool-Down: End your workout with a 5-10 minute low-intensity ride to gradually decrease your heart rate. Follow with static stretches to improve flexibility and decrease muscle discomfort.
Biking Intervals

HIIT (High-Intensity Interval Training): Alternate in between short bursts of extreme biking (e.g., 30 seconds) and longer periods of recovery (e.g., 1-2 minutes). This technique can improve your metabolic process and improve cardiovascular physical fitness.
Endurance Rides: Aim for longer, steady-state rides to develop endurance. Start with 20-30 minutes and gradually increase the duration as your fitness enhances.
Integrate Resistance

Utilize the resistance settings to mimic different terrains, such as hills. Increasing the resistance can assist build strength and burn more calories.
Try out various resistance levels to keep your workouts challenging and engaging.
Use Virtual Cycling Apps

Numerous apps and online platforms provide virtual biking experiences, allowing you to ride through picturesque paths or participate in virtual classes. These can add variety and motivation to your exercises.
Some popular apps include Zwift, Peloton, and RGT Cycling.
Track Your Progress

Purchase a heart rate screen or utilize the built-in tracking features of your bike to monitor your development. Set specific goals, such as increasing your typical speed or improving your VO2 max, and track your achievements in time.
Common Mistakes to Avoid
Poor Posture

Ensure your back is straight and your core is engaged. Leaning too far forward or backward can result in discomfort and poor type.
Overtraining

While it's crucial to challenge yourself, overtraining can lead to burnout and injury. Start with a workable exercise schedule and [Redirect Only] gradually increase the intensity and duration.
Overlooking Hydration

Stay hydrated throughout your exercise. Dehydration can result in fatigue and reduced performance.
Overlooking Warm-Up and Cool-Down

Avoiding the warm-up and cool-down can increase the threat of injury and minimize the effectiveness of your workout. Constantly make the effort to effectively prepare and recover.
Frequently Asked Questions About Bicycle Home Exercise
Q: Is a stationary bicycle as effective as outside cycling?

A: While the experience might differ, stationary bicycles can be just as reliable for cardiovascular and muscular physical fitness. They offer the benefit of controlled resistance and weather-proof conditions, making it simpler to keep a consistent routine.
Q: How frequently should I use a stationary bike?

A: For basic physical fitness, go for 3-4 sessions each week, each lasting 30-60 minutes. If you're training for a particular event or objective, you may need to increase the frequency and duration of your workouts.
Q: Can I utilize a stationary bicycle if I have knee issues?

A: Yes, biking is a low-impact activity that can be helpful for those with knee concerns. However, it's crucial to start with a low resistance and focus on appropriate type to avoid exacerbating any current conditions. Talk to a doctor if you have concerns.
Q: What are the advantages of using a spin bike versus a regular stationary bike?

A: Spin bikes are designed for high-intensity workouts and provide a more dynamic and challenging experience. They often have heavier flywheels and more robust resistance settings, which can help construct strength and endurance. Routine stationary bikes, on the other hand, appropriate for a broader range of fitness levels and offer a more comfortable and low-impact exercise.
Q: How can I make my biking exercises more fascinating?

A: To keep your exercises engaging, try using virtual cycling apps, differing your resistance levels, and incorporating various kinds of rides (e.g., [Redirect-302] sprints, hills, endurance). You can also listen to music, podcasts, or audiobooks to make your sessions more satisfying.
